Choosing Compatible Nappy Bin Refills: What German Parents Need to Know
These 16-pack refill cassettes for octagonal diaper pails represent a specific compatibility challenge. Unlike universal liners, they must precisely match the locking mechanisms and film feed systems of Tommee Tippee, Angelcare, and LitterLocker units. Buyers should verify their exact pail model before purchasing, as octagonal designs have unique cartridge requirements.
Key Considerations Before Buying
- Compatibility verification is paramount—these cassettes specifically fit octagonal pails, not round models, and must match your unit's internal locking tabs.
- Film thickness and odor barrier quality vary significantly between refill brands; these claim compatibility but may differ from OEM film performance.
- The 16-cassette quantity represents approximately 4-6 months of supply for average usage, making storage space a practical consideration.
What Our Analysts Recommend
Examine reviews mentioning specific pail models (like Tommee Tippee Sangenic or Angelcare Deluxe) to confirm fit. Quality indicators include consistent film perforation for easy tearing, sturdy cassette construction that won't jam, and film that resists tearing during loading. Authentic reviews often mention whether the film feels thinner or thicker than original manufacturer refills.

Common Issues
The most frequent complaints involve compatibility mismatches—cassettes that don't lock properly or film that doesn't feed smoothly. Other issues include film that tears prematurely, weak odor seals, or cassettes that arrive damaged during shipping due to their plastic construction.
Quality Indicators
Look for mentions of film opacity (thicker film usually indicates better odor containment) and cassette durability. Quality third-party refills maintain the original's core functions: reliable film advancement, secure closure mechanisms, and adequate odor control without claiming identical performance to OEM products.
